    After switching to object mode and importing a video, it's impossible to switch back to drawing mode. only object mode is available. Why ?

    • @tuat555
      @tuat555  9 หลายเดือนก่อน

      Okay so let's say you're in the viewport and you just imported your reference... and now at the top right corner of Blender there's the outliner panel. In it, you should find every object in the scene (the grease pencil elements, the camera, your reference,etc)...what you need to do is to click on the grease pencil object in this panel. And then try to switch mode...you should have access to the draw mode in that way 👍. Hope that helps 😁🌟.

      Ummm 🤔 could you tell me more about it (I'm trying to figure out the situation). So you're trying to do the interpolation right? If it the case, look at your timeline. The interpolation or in-between works if you do have 2 main keyframes. (That the requirements). Then you will need to place the playhead somewhere in-between these 2 keyframes. Now by using the interpolation you should get the in-between. I hope I don't confuse you too much...let me know how this work 🙂👍

    Is it possible to export the video with the animated grease pencil lines?

    • @tuat555
      @tuat555  6 หลายเดือนก่อน

      Yes of course 😁👍! Basically if you're familiar with the software you will have to import your video not as a "reference" but as an "image plane". In that way the video will appear in the render as well as your grease pencil over it ✌️🌟
